Runbook bit for the Cartledger shipping-fee rules engine — future maintainers, read this before you touch anything. When fees come out wrong, it's almost never the rules themselves; it's usually a stale rule bundle or a zone table that didn't reload. Force a bundle refresh first, then replay a sample order through the dry-run endpoint and compare. If that's clean, suspect config. The engine should be running with the following values, and nothing else:

settings of fafog-haduf:
ZORIX_PIN=4648
ZORIX_METRICS_HOST=metrics.zorix.paliqsys.corp
ZORIX_LOG_LEVEL=info
ZORIX_TENANT=druix

# Fernhook Environments

Quick orientation for whoever inherits this: Fernhook delivers webhooks with exponential backoff, and each environment tunes the retry knobs differently. Dev gives up fast so you're not staring at a stuck queue; staging mirrors prod timing so load tests mean something. Prod retries for roughly a day before dead-lettering. Don't "fix" dev to match prod — that's intentional. The per-environment retry settings are listed below:

service settings:
[casax]
port = 6379
team = rusir
host = casax.zemvarhq.corp
region = outer-4
access_code = ac_9808ce
timeout_ms = 1500

Subject: DR drill Tuesday — SlimForge

Team,

Tuesday 0900 we run the SlimForge disaster drill. SlimForge strips container images before deploy; the drill simulates losing its build cache entirely. Expect slower ticket builds for an hour. Don't escalate image-size complaints during the window — tag them DRILL. Support leads must verify access to the fallback registry beforehand. Unlock the fallback registry console with the passphrase below.

unlock words, fafop-hawep: briwyn-oliix-sorox

Hi Darya — handing over Pellwick release duties. Config hot-reload is live on the ingest tier: edits to runtime.yaml apply within ten seconds, no restart. Watch the reload counter metric; if it stalls, the watcher thread has died and a rolling restart is required. All config bundles must be signed before the agents accept them, using the key below.

rollout seal: bky4_x7Gc